Does a police report include insurance information? Yes. The UD-10 Michigan car accident police report that is filled out after a crash includes both insurance company and insurance policy number information for each vehicle involved in the crash.

How to File an Accident Report in Detroit, MichiganCall 911 to report a Detroit accident immediately after it occurs.File a police report for an accident or incident that has already occurred by calling the Detroit Police Department's telephone crime reporting number at 313-267-4600.

You have to report a car accident within 3 days. However, it's important to report the car accident with as close of proximity to the actual accident as possible.

Police Departments: State and local law enforcement agencies may also be able to provide basic information about auto accidents. If you call a local police department, they may be able to tell you if an official crash report listed a person's name as having been involved in an accident in recent days/hours.

2 Ways to Get A Copy Of Your Report On-Line In MichiganOrder Online Through Michigan State Police Traffic Crash Purchasing System. The Traffic Crash Purchasing System (TCPS) offers a means to purchase a traffic crash report submitted by all Michigan law enforcement agencies.Other Data Sites like LexisNexis or CrashDocs.

Michigan law does not require the driver to file a written accident report. Instead, the driver must report the accident "at the nearest or most convenient police station, or to the nearest or most convenient police officer." This means that the accident should be reported in person.
